HIP 5652

HIP 5652 is a G-type (Yellow) star located in the constellation Andromeda.

At a distance of roughly 1,437 light-years, HIP 5652 is a distant star lying deep within the Milky Way galaxy.

HIP 5652 is classified as a spectral class G star (G-type (Yellow)) on the Harvard spectral classification system.

HIP 5652 has an apparent magnitude of +8.13, placing it beyond naked-eye visibility. A good pair of binoculars or a small telescope is required to observe this star. Observers will note its orange hue, which corresponds to a B-V color index of +1.050.
